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
745423515 81080994 9775002 42033
24293384 0672524616 60
24293384 0672524616 60
57642981 429 3255 535508738 9362
All about undefined
Interested in learning more?
24293384 0672524616 60
57642981 429 3255 535508738 9362
See more
51666869 1343 379568
1453575 703 8706182579
See more
471304053 5028539
1341488 402 3469454171 6985
See more